King article on scheduling: interesting note on potential Chiefs schedule...

KC could have opened with 5 of 7 on road in one scenario. That would have been brutal...

http://mmqb.si.com/2014/04/24/making...-nfl-schedule/

Quote:
“We threw away probably 175 schedules that we’d have played without batting an eye five years ago,” Katz said.

Said North: “Any one of these 4,400 seeds might be the one that leads you to the finished schedule. Any one might be a dead end. You’ve got to play all of them out. But on April 16, this finished schedule popped out, and we couldn’t find one after that to beat it.”

There almost was one. Before I tell you about the schedule that won the beauty contest, let me tell you about the schedule that finished in second place. If that one had won, the Seattle Seahawks would have been steamed.

The runner-up schedule had two major Seattle glitches that NFL hates to hand teams: a three-game road trip, and a road game after a Monday night road game. And they would have happened in the same three-game stretch. In mid-season, Seattle would have played at St. Louis on a Sunday, at Washington on a Monday night, and at Kansas City on a Sunday.

Anyplace east of Spokane is far from Seattle, obviously. But this schedule would have been a killer. First a 1,787-mile flight to St. Louis, and back after the game. Then a 2,311-mile flight to Baltimore-Washington Airport, and back after the game. Then a 1,407-mile flight to Kansas City, and back after the game. That’s 11,010 air miles in 15 days … unless, of course, the Seahawks spent a week in the Midwest or East to minimize one of the back-and-forths. Commissioner Roger Goodell is the final approver-in-chief of the schedule, and I wondered whether he’d have approved one that had the Super Bowl champion with such a brutal 15-day stretch.

“Would you have played that schedule?” I asked Katz.

“Yeah, I think so,” he said. “We didn’t want to. We were hopeful that we’d find a better one. I think we would have, and we did. If we had to play it, I think we would have had an interesting discussion with Roger about it. We had many interesting discussions in this room about it—whether it was a fatal flaw or not. I didn’t deem it fatal, but we were hoping we could find a way out of it.”

North chimed in then. “So it turns into a robbing Peter to pay Paul scenario,” he said. “If you want to fix this Seattle problem, who do you want to break in exchange? This was a schedule that we gave serious consideration to—look at this start for Kansas City.”

North put a schedule on the monitor in the room with a dreadful opening for Kansas City: five road games in the first seven weeks. “Would we have played a schedule, if everything else was good, with five of Kansas City’s first seven on the road, including a three-game road trip—left coast, right coast, left coast?” North said.

“The answer was no,” Katz said.

“That schedule fixed Seattle, but it broke Kansas City worse than what we were doing with Seattle,” North said.


“You fix one team,” said Katz, “and 12 more problems come up.”
